Pobeda charged in UEFA match case
UEFA has announced today that FK Pobeda, its president and one of the players have been charged for breaching the principles of integrity and sportsmanship with manipulation of the outcome of the match between Pobeda and Pyunik from Armenia on 13 July 2004.

Slobodan Vujcic in FK Pobeda
The well known actor in the Macedonian football parody, Slobodan Vujcić – Braco is back in the domestic football. Braco's new role is main sponsor of the former Macedonian champion FK Pobeda Prilep.
